Output ab76bb8d5509471145ab4c7890578d6f1bfd3040c3fd1562a5a66b9f960fb66f:0

value
8776292
script pubkey
OP_0 OP_PUSHBYTES_20 ec5bc7d2e7a29da29243445905496a93a1b5abd8
address
bc1qa3du05h852w69yjrg3vs2jt2jwsmt27clu5hc9
transaction
ab76bb8d5509471145ab4c7890578d6f1bfd3040c3fd1562a5a66b9f960fb66f